CVE-2020-26299

Path Traversal in npm/ftp-srv

Identifiers

CVE-2020-26299, GHSA-pmw4-jgxx-pcq9

Package Slug

npm/ftp-srv

Vulnerability

Path Traversal

Description

ftp-srv is an open-source FTP server designed to be simple yet configurable. In ftp-srv there is a path-traversal vulnerability. Clients of FTP servers utilizing ftp-srv hosted on Windows machines can escape the FTP user's defined root folder using the expected FTP commands, for example, CWD and UPDR. When windows separators exist within the path (\), path.resolve leaves the upper pointers intact and allows the user to move beyond the root folder defined for that user. We did not take that into account when creating the path resolve function. The issue is patched (commit b859450a37cba10ff3c431eb4aa67771122e3).

Affected Versions

All versions before 4.4.0

Solution

Upgrade to version 4.4.0 or above.
